LYYN launches a new product, the LYYN Griffin, that enables customers to use their analog cameras and distribute the enhanced video via a IP network infrastructure. The product is designed for easy interoperability and is ONVIF compliant.
”This launch is part of out strategy to increase market share in the surveillance market. Our traditional customers use fully analog CCTV systems but the market for hybrid installations is growing fast, where the video signal is distributed via IP network. We can now deliver video enhancement to this market.
Previously, if customers wanted to distribute video via a network they had to install a video encoder themselves after our products. Now we have made it easier for these customers since we have integrated our technology with an ONVIF compliant video encoder into a turnkey plug-n-play product. This new product is an important part of our strategy for growth within the network video market. The field tests we have carried out together with a US customer confirms both the functionality and the application” says Bengt Sahlberg, President. ”First shipments will start in August this year.”
